Web22 Feb 2024 · Pouring Melted Wax Into a Jar Lone Star Candle Supply 3.73K subscribers Subscribe 69 Share Save 19K views 5 years ago How to Make a Candle, Start to Finish … WebThe temperature is one of the most important things to get right, so read on to find out more about what temperature you should pour the wax at to create a successful gel candle. When pouring your gel wax, the temperature should be 185-200 °F. If you pour the wax when it is too cold or too hot, this can cause bubbles in the gel, a cloudy ...

Webmovement. The single best way to avoid getting air bubbles in your glass jar candles is to make sure to pre-heat your glass jars to about 160 degrees before pouring your candle wax into them. This is, of course, difficult to measure, but setting your glass jars in an oven that's heated to about that temperature for five minutes should do the trick. Web29 Apr 2024 · Use a double boiler for old pillar candles and place them on the top to melt. Once melted use a fork to pull out the wick. For old candles in a glass container (or tin), place them in a water bath in a saucepan on medium heat. Pour the wax out into a silicone mold for wax melts or make new candles.
